Transaction dc16c12b587ed02dfbddbf5dabe7d3fd0f4a1fc7bbb489c14640bc2d69cc2665
1 Input
1 Output
-
dc16c12b587ed02dfbddbf5dabe7d3fd0f4a1fc7bbb489c14640bc2d69cc2665:0
- value
- 32246129
- script pubkey
- OP_0 OP_PUSHBYTES_20 39528507b8ba48a7c55a4f5a337016fa18aab5c6
- address
- bc1q89fg2pachfy20326fadrxuqklgv24dwx0axew9